Game 91: Orioles 6, Indians 5
The Good:
- Alfredo Simon did a nice job, showing why I was a fan of him as a reliever. Tonight notwithstanding, he isn't really a starter - but he can be solid out of the pen. Final line; 7 IP, 3 H, 2 R, 1 BB, 5 K. That's the best start for an O's pitcher in quite a while, so I think the Shutdown Sauce moniker is apt.
- Koji was his usual awesome self in relief - perfect inning with 2 K's.
- Nick Markakis doubled twice and homered; almost getting his slugging percentage above .400 for the season.
- Matt Wieters walked twice, while Mark Reynolds doubled and walked.
- In all, the 8 of the O's 9 hits went for extra bases and they drew 4 free passes. More of that please.
- Even being given a four run lead to work with, Kevin Gregg managed to make things way too "interesting", walking the bases loaded and then having them cleared on a double. Good thing Mike Gonzalez saved the day (almost can't believe I wrote that).
